CapSolver 焕新登场

演员运行

Actor 运行

Actor 运行是指在云自动化平台(如 CapSolver)上对 Actor 或任务的单独执行实例。

定义

Actor 运行是指对 Actor 或任务的特定调用,每次您使用给定参数(如输入、内存分配和超时设置)启动时都会创建一个运行。它封装了该执行的所有信息,包括日志、数据输出以及运行期间使用的资源。用户可以监控运行进度、检查日志,并访问存储在键值存储或数据集中的结构化结果。Actor 运行使得可以一致且可靠地跟踪和管理重复的自动化任务。这一概念是协调可扩展的网络爬虫、自动化和数据提取工作流的核心,适用于支持无服务器执行的平台。

优点

  • 为每个自动化任务提供清晰的隔离执行环境。
  • 可独立监控性能、日志和输出。
  • 通过为每次运行封装输入和设置,支持可重复性。
  • 支持与存储系统集成,实现结构化结果处理。
  • 在无需手动管理基础设施的情况下扩展自动化任务。

缺点

  • 每次运行都会消耗平台资源,可能产生费用。
  • 短暂的运行仍可能因启动延迟产生开销。
  • 复杂的工作流可能需要管理多个独立运行。
  • 没有适当的日志记录,跨多个运行进行调试可能具有挑战性。
  • 运行依赖于正确的输入配置才能产生有用的结果。

使用场景

  • 对特定目标 URL 和计划的网络爬虫任务进行自动化。
  • 执行具有定义输入和输出的浏览器自动化任务。
  • 运行定时数据提取任务,用于价格监控或潜在客户生成。
  • 处理需要重复、参数化执行的 API 工作流。
  • 与需要从网络获取结构化数据的 AI 管道集成。